Alt-Rock Trio Desert Mountain Tribe Return With Surging Second Album

June 1, 2018

The album, ‘Om Parvat Mystery’, is named after an ancient holy mountain in the Himalayas. On a recent radio appearance, the band also joked that it was because making the album had been an uphill struggle, with half being recorded in the UK and half in the Faroe Islands.

Jungle – ‘HAPPY MAN’

May 24, 2018

Jungle was founded in 2013 by childhood friends Tom McFarland and Josh Lloyd-Watson, who came to be known as “J and T”. From there they expanded into a seven piece lineup – changing their name to Jungle – giving their live shows a full and organic experience.

Essentially Pop Meets: Young Earth At Inaugural #IrishMusicParty Showcase

April 14, 2018

Young Earth are four guys who met at BIMM and decided to put together a band in late 2016. Their take on indie pop is fresh and new, with a fusion of the heavier elements of rock alongside hooky pop. In other words, a great sound.
